why might mark twain have written about lower-class citizens in his satires?
a. to ensure that he wrote only about topics with which he was familiar
b. to reflect the realities of life in his writings
c. to ignore the upper class, which he did not see as being worthy of his attention
d. to give readers a sense of what his life was like as a child
Mark Twain's satires aimed to critique and portray the authentic conditions of 19th-century American society. Focusing on lower-class citizens allowed him to depict the often-overlooked, harsh realities of everyday life, which was a core goal of his realist-leaning satirical work. Option A is incorrect as he wrote about diverse topics beyond his direct familiarity; Option C is wrong because he did address upper-class issues in his works; Option D is inaccurate as this was not the primary intent of his satirical focus on lower classes.
